
From: Royce Lv <lvroyce@linux.vnet.ibm.com> To format xml used to create cdrom, and to parse and filter cdrom query results, add three helper function to do this. Signed-off-by: Royce Lv <lvroyce@linux.vnet.ibm.com> --- src/kimchi/model.py | 42 ++++++++++++++++++++++++++++++++++++++++++ src/kimchi/xmlutils.py | 5 +++++ 2 files changed, 47 insertions(+) diff --git a/src/kimchi/model.py b/src/kimchi/model.py index a21fcf7..c74c973 100644 --- a/src/kimchi/model.py +++ b/src/kimchi/model.py @@ -1672,6 +1672,48 @@ def _get_volume_xml(**kwargs): return xml +def _get_disk_xml(**kwargs): + kwargs['readonly'] = "<readonly/>" \ + if kwargs['target']['type'] == 'cdrom' else None + xml = """ + <disk type='{source[type]}' device='{target[type]}'> + <source file='{source[path]}'/> + <target dev='{target[name]}' bus='{target[bus]}'/> + {readonly} + </disk> + """.format(**kwargs) + return dict(xml=xml) + + +def _parse_vm_disks(xml_str, filter_path, filter_name, filter_val): + # xml_str: xml_str of all disks + # filter_path: xpath of the filter attribute, + # such as './disk' or './disk/target' + # filter_name: relative path of filter attr of disks etree element + # such as: type, bus + # filter_val: expected value of filter name + root = ElementTree.fromstring(xml_str) + ret = [] + xpath = "%s/[@%s='%s']" % (filter_path, filter_name, filter_val) + for disk in root.findall(xpath): + name = disk.find('./target').attrib['dev'] + ret.append(name) + + return ret + + +def _parse_device(xml_str, dev_name): + xpath = "./disk/target[@dev='%s']/.." % dev_name + root = ElementTree.fromstring(xml_str) + ret = [] + disk = root.find(xpath) + if disk: + path = disk.find('./source').attrib['file'] + return dict(name=dev_name, path=path) + else: + raise NotFoundError + + class LibvirtConnection(object): def __init__(self, uri): self.uri = uri diff --git a/src/kimchi/xmlutils.py b/src/kimchi/xmlutils.py index 51ff0ec..176ceb1 100644 --- a/src/kimchi/xmlutils.py +++ b/src/kimchi/xmlutils.py @@ -40,3 +40,8 @@ def xml_item_update(xml, xpath, value): item = root.find(xpath) item.text = value return ElementTree.tostring(root, encoding="utf-8") + +def xml_get_child(xml, xpath): + root = ElementTree.fromstring(xml) + item = root.find(xpath) + return ElementTree.tostring(item, encoding="utf-8") -- 1.8.1.2
